And more congratulations

Two terrific new first books: Anna Journey's IF BIRDS GATHER YOUR HAIR FOR NESTING, a winner of the National Poetry Series, chosen by Thom Lux. And Paul Otremba's THE CURRENCY, just published by Four Way Books. There's something truly heartening about
wonderful first books -- the sense of arrival, a sensibility that already seems achieved, even in its initial appearance, a new way of seeing and speaking.
